Are Industrial Vacuums Worth It?

When evaluating whether industrial vacuums justify their higher cost compared to consumer models, the decision hinges on application requirements, long-term savings, and operational efficiency. While normal vacuums suffice for light household tasks, industrial vacuums are engineered for heavy-duty, continuous use in harsh environments. Abajo, we break down the factors that determine their value, providing a data-driven perspective to help you decide.

1. Key Advantages of Industrial Vacuums

a. Superior Performance in Demanding Environments

  • Handles Tough Materials: Industrial vacuums extract metal shavings, concrete dust, wet sludge, and hazardous particles (P.EJ., asbestos, silica) without clogging or motor failure.
  • Continuous Duty Cycles: Unlike consumer vacuums that overheat under prolonged use, industrial models operate 24/7 in factories, construction sites, or manufacturing plants.
  • Customizable Filtration: HEPA filters (99.97%+ eficiencia), cyclonic separation, or wet/dry systems ensure compliance with safety standards (P.EJ., OSHA, EPA).

b. Long-Term Cost Savings

  • Reduced Downtime: Heavy-duty motors and reinforced construction minimize breakdowns, avoiding production delays.
  • Lower Maintenance Costs: Durable hoses, filtros, and motors last longer than consumer-grade components, reducing replacement expenses.
  • Compliance Risk Mitigation: Industrial vacuums prevent fines or shutdowns by meeting regulatory dust-control requirements.

c. Enhanced Safety and Worker Health

  • Dust Extraction: Removes harmful particles (P.EJ., welding fumes, silica) at the source, reducing respiratory risks.
  • Explosion-Proof Models: ATEX-certified vacuums prevent ignition of flammable dust in industries like pharmaceuticals or grain processing.

2. When Industrial Vacuums Are Overkill

a. Light-Duty Applications

  • If your needs are limited to household cleaning, office spaces, or small workshops, a consumer vacuum (P.EJ., $100–$300) es suficiente.
  • Example: Cleaning carpets, pet hair, or light debris.

b. Budget Constraints

  • Industrial vacuums cost 2–5x more than consumer models. If budgets are tight and tasks are minimal, investing in a high-end consumer vacuum may be more practical.

c. Infrequent or Non-Hazardous Use

  • For occasional cleaning of non-toxic, dry materials (P.EJ., dusting retail stores), a normal vacuum may suffice.

4. Industry-Specific Use Cases Where Industrial Vacuums Excel

a. Manufacturing and CNC Machining

  • Removes metal chips, refrigerante, and welding fumes from machinery, preventing equipment damage and worker exposure to toxins.

b. Construction and Renovation

  • Cleans concrete dust, silica, and wet slurry from floors, walls, and tools, reducing respiratory hazards and project delays.

c. Pharmaceuticals and Food Processing

  • Uses HEPA-filtered vacuums to prevent cross-contamination in sterile environments, meeting FDA and GMP standards.

d. Automotriz y aeroespacial

  • Extracts oil, grasa, and metal shavings from engines, sistemas hidráulicos, and aircraft components, ensuring precision and safety.

Conclusion: Is the Investment Worth It?

, if your operations involve:

  • Heavy, continuo, or hazardous material handling.
  • Compliance with safety or environmental regulations.
  • Reducing downtime, costos de mantenimiento, or worker health risks.

No, if your needs are limited to light, infrequent, or non-hazardous cleaning.

Preguntas frecuentes:

  1. Q: How do I justify the higher cost of an industrial vacuum to stakeholders?
    A: Present a cost-benefit analysis highlighting reduced downtime, lower maintenance, and compliance savings. Por ejemplo, a $3,000 industrial vacuum may save $10,000+ annually in avoided fines or production delays.
  1. Q: Can I use an industrial vacuum for both wet and dry materials?
    A: Sí, but ensure the model is rated for wet/dry use and has proper filtration (P.EJ., float valve for liquids). Avoid using normal vacuums with wet materials, as this risks motor damage.
  1. Q: What compliance standards should I prioritize when sourcing industrial vacuums?
    A: For hazardous environments, seek ATEX (explosion-proof), OSHA (dust control), or EPA (emissions) certifications. Always verify certifications with the supplier and request documentation.
